Our Mission Much Better Adventures exists to prove that travel can be a powerful force for good. Our ambition is nothing less than to lead the world in positive-impact adventure travel - setting new standards for how tourism can support conservation and create lasting local economic impact. We believe the future of travel isn’t about doing less harm. It’s about creating more good. And we believe adventure travel, when done right, can play a major role in tackling our society's biggest challenges.

The Opportunity This is a rare and exciting opportunity to shape the future of positive impact travel. We are looking for an ambitious leader to elevate and evolve our impact strategy, bringing fresh thinking, bold ideas and a challenger mindset to an industry that urgently needs it. Someone who is energised by the chance to question norms, push boundaries, and help redefine what “responsible travel” really means. You will work directly alongside the CEO to expand the direction, ambition and parameters of our impact strategy - and you’ll have the full backing of the business to bring it to life. This is not a role about maintaining frameworks or ticking boxes; it’s about innovation, leadership and influence, both inside Much Better Adventures and across the wider travel industry.

The Role As Head of Impact, you will own the evolution and delivery of Much Better Adventures’ impact agenda - ensuring impact is embedded at the heart of how we operate, grow, partner and tell our story. The role spans two interconnected dimensions: Vision & Strategy: Working with the CEO to define what leadership in positive-impact travel looks like, and shaping the strategy to deliver it - setting ambition, priorities, principles and framework Activation & Influence: Turning that vision into reality with our hosts, and through powerful industry engagement You’ll collaborate closely with Operations, Expansion, Product, Marketing and Leadership, and act as a senior external voice for Much Better Adventures on impact and innovation.

Requirements We're looking for a Head of Impact who can set a strong long-term vision and also lead the practical changes needed to deliver it. You’ll bring: A strong understanding of the key impact areas in travel, including: carbon emissions, nature, local communities, and responsible supply chains Senior leadership experience embedding sustainability and impact into a consumer-facing business A genuine belief in the role travel can play in creating positive change, alongside the ability to navigate its challenges Curiosity and a commitment to continuous learning, as the impact landscape and best practice continue to evolve Confidence influencing across teams, partners and senior leadership A challenger mindset - excited to question assumptions and rethink how things are done Strong communication skills, from grassroots partners to board-level conversations.
